Browse intent in 2026 has moved beyond basic geographical markers. While a user in Seattle may have once tried to find general services throughout WA, the expectation now is for hyper-local accuracy. This shift is driven by the increase of Generative Engine Optimization (GEO) and AI-driven search models that prioritize immediate distance and real-time availability over conventional ranking signals. Online search engine no longer deal with a city as a single block. An inquiry made in the center of Seattle produces different outcomes than one made just a couple of blocks away.
Steve Morris, CEO of NEWMEDIA.COM, has actually argued in significant tech publications that the era of broad SEO is being changed by "distance clusters." According to Morris, AI search representatives now weigh a company's physical area versus real-time data points like local traffic, existing weather, and social belief within a couple of square miles. For services running in WA, this suggests that presence is no longer ensured by high-volume keywords alone. Presence now depends on how well a brand name's data is structured for these AI-driven local evaluations.

Most of hyper-local searches take place on mobile gadgets or through AI-integrated hardware. This makes technical website design more essential than ever. A site needs to fill instantly and provide the specific information an AI representative needs to satisfy a user's request. This includes structured information for inventory, pricing, and service hours that are particular to a single area. Distance optimization also considers the "digital footprint" of an area. This includes regional reviews, mentions in neighborhood news outlets, and even social media check-ins. AI designs utilize these signals to verify that a business is active and credible in Seattle. If a brand name has a strong nationwide presence however no local engagement in WA, it might discover itself outranked by a smaller competitor that has focused on hyper-local signals.
As AI agents become the main way people discover services in the United States, the accuracy of regional information is non-negotiable. Contrasting information about a location's address or services can lead to a total loss of exposure. Steve Morris has noted that "data fragmentation" is among the most significant difficulties for brand names in 2026. If an AI assistant gets three different sets of hours for a company in Seattle, it will likely suggest a competitor with more consistent data.
